A typical motherboard contains a variety/range/selection of crucial components, each with its own specific/unique/distinct role.
- Central Processing Unit (CPU): The brain of the computer, responsible for executing instructions and performing calculations.
- Random Access Memory (RAM): Provides fast, temporary storage for data and programs currently in use.
- Storage Devices: Such as hard drives or solid-state drives (SSDs), store your operating system, applications, and files permanently.
- Expansion Slots: Allow you to add peripheral devices/hardware components/connectivity options like graphics cards, sound cards, or network adapters.
- Motherboard Chipset: Controls the flow of data between the CPU, RAM, and other components.
Choosing the Right Motherboard for Your Needs
Building a powerful PC involves picking the right components. One of the most essential components is the motherboard, the foundation that connects all your devices. Selecting the right motherboard can greatly impact the efficiency of your system.
Consider your specific needs and budget when making your decision. Are you a casual user? What kind of software will you be utilizing? Do you need extra PCIe slots for graphics cards or other devices?
Research the different types of motherboards available, such as ATX, micro-ATX, and mini-ITX. Each size has its own advantages and cons. Once you have a better understanding of your requirements, you can refine your options and find the perfect motherboard for your computer.
